Output 5c4079b38c1ced309431b39621ba7f3ac645e7fedd709be38ac2993417968531:1

value
20044911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 539453b11e34cd72ab357ef6ae79eb51b0678b8c OP_EQUAL
address
39JwhQCiETDh6P2Lsv3GeAatAjCccWopZy
transaction
5c4079b38c1ced309431b39621ba7f3ac645e7fedd709be38ac2993417968531
confirmations
500231
spent
true